  • Patent number: 11636419
    Abstract: A method for plant efficiency evaluation includes a first step of displaying in a first graphical zone a set of operators and a set of operands in a second graphical zone. A formula editor user interface is provided in a third graphical zone which enables a drag and drop of an operator or an operand for creating a formula for a plant performance indicator (PPI) as a measure of plant efficiency. When an operand is dropped into the third graphical zone, automatically displaying for the dropped operand a predefined list of entities involved in a production process of the plant, the predefined list enabling a selection of an entity for said operand. Data are then automatically collected for selected entity for each operand that has been dragged and dropped in the third graphical zone, and the PPI is a automatically calculated from the formula and the collected data.

  • Publication number: 20190056855
    Abstract: A system and a method for planning and monitoring operating states of machines of a plant. A new model for operating states of a machine of a plant is configured within a single graphical editor that is capable of listing states and categories of states for each of the machines of the plant as a function of status-related data generated by the machines. The status-related data is automatically collected from the machine of the plant. The status-related data collected from the machine is automatically matched with the operating states listed in the new model. The operating states of the machine are automatically displayed as a function of the time for a given period of time.
